Step-by-Step Guide to Calibrating a GPS Dog Fence

1. Choose a Safe and Appropriate Boundary

Select an open area that gives your dog enough room to play, but avoids hazards like busy roads, cliffs, or deep water. Use landmarks like trees, fences or posts as reference points. Make mental or physical markers for the outer edge of your preferred boundary.

2. Activate and Configure the GPS Device

Once activated, the unit will begin locating satellite signals to determine your position. Make sure the device is in "Boundary Setting" or “Initial Calibration” mode as described in its user manual.

3. Walk the Boundary

Physically walk the perimeter of the containment area with the receiver collar in hand. Hold the collar at your dog's neck height to replicate actual use. This helps the collar map the intended zone, learning where to send alert and correction signals based on GPS coordinates. Walk slowly and steadily to improve accuracy.

4. Set Correction Levels

Once the perimeter is mapped, set appropriate correction levels. Levels usually include tone, vibration, and moderate static stimulation. Start with the lowest setting and gradually adjust based on your dog’s size, breed, and temperament. 5. Perform Test Runs

With the boundary recorded and corrections set, test the fence without your dog. Approach the boundaries holding the collar at your dog’s neck height. The collar should give a warning signal just before reaching the limit. If the timing is off, recalibrate and repeat the process until the warning zone is accurate—ideally 5-10 feet inside the chosen boundary.

6. Introduce Your Dog Gradually

Once calibration is complete and the system functions correctly, introduce your dog to the setup in short, controlled training sessions. Use positive reinforcement and teach boundary awareness through repeated exposure. Begin with tone-only warnings before moving to vibration or static as needed.

Tips for Successful Calibration

  • Use landmarks: Trees, fences, or fire hydrants can help reinforce boundary recognition for your dog.

  • Ensure full satellite visibility: Calibration and daily operation require clear access to the sky—avoid dense tree canopies or metal structures that may interfere with signals.
  • Monitor battery levels: A low battery can affect the accuracy of GPS readings; charge the collar routinely.

Signs That Recalibration May Be Needed

Even the most reliable systems can drift due to heavy cloud cover, solar interference, or geographic changes. You may need to recalibrate your device if:

  • Your dog receives a correction in a safe zone
  • The warnings occur too late or too early
  • You’ve moved to a different location or home
  • You experience prolonged GPS signal loss
